Archive

‘Javascript’ 分類過的Archive

靠!twcount統計程式有雷

2011年10月5日 尚無評論
大家不要上當
這個統計程式藏有一支廣告程式
有嵌入的趕快移除
它會不定時自動跳出一則色情廣告的連結
用Google檢查元素後發現,就是twcount網站
而且無法關閉
點關閉也會強迫轉往該色情網站
重點是它竟然還寫 "網站所有資料全部免費提供"
這是甚麼意思阿,讓不了解的人誤會那就糟了
這是我擷圖後放到Flickr的
它的彈出視窗裡面有寫如下語法:
<img src="http://s1.twcount.com/welcome.jpg" href="javascript:void(0)"
title="cover" onclick="var
lkistbvkp=window.open('http://www.sexdvd2000.com/index.php?id=i18858604',
'jjkrebmz','toolbar=yes,location=yes,status=yes,menubar=yes,scrollbars=yes,
resizable=yes,width=1280,height=800');lkistbvkp.blur();
document.getElementById('eipyuknjqaz').style.display='none';
document.getElementById('dfekgtivbsw').style.display='none';">

有安裝的趕快移除吧要放色情廣告都不通知的,實在太狡猾了!

Categories: Javascript, 電腦相關 Tags:

受保護的文章:自訂ckeditor工具列工具

2011年1月23日 輸入您的密碼方能觀看迴響。

本文受密碼保護,須填寫您的密碼才能閱讀。


Categories: Javascript Tags:

可以在前端實現的幾個地理位置小功能

2010年12月10日 尚無評論

原文網址:http://www.oncoding.cn/2010/geo-location-frontend/

在Smashing Magazine上看到這篇Entering The Wonderful World of Geo Location,介紹了獲取並處理用戶地理位置的應用和方法,很有意思。結合原文的內容,加上之前的一些應用,整理了幾個可以完全在前端實現的地理位置相關小功能。
1.通過IP獲取用戶位置
很多時候需要通過IP判斷用戶的位置,通常的辦法是通過自己的後臺程式查詢資料庫得到。如果用戶位置只是應用在前端,或者有其他的特殊原因(比如,懶:),也有一些其他辦法來快速的獲取用戶位置。
maxmind.com提供了一個服務,通過引入一個js檔(http://j.maxmind.com/app/geoip.js),可以把他判斷到的用戶的國家、城市、經緯度等資訊加入到頁面中來。下面是從青島訪問這個js檔返回的內容:

function geoip_country_code() { return 'CN'; }
function geoip_country_name() { return 'China'; }
function geoip_city() { return 'Qingdao'; }
function geoip_region() { return '25'; }
function geoip_region_name() { return 'Shandong'; }
function geoip_latitude() { return '36.0986'; }
function geoip_longitude() { return '120.3719'; }
function geoip_postal_code() { return ''; }

閱讀全文...

Categories: Javascript, PHP Tags: , , , ,

3種jQuery UI Dialog取值、賦值的範例

2010年12月9日 尚無評論

由於使用jQuery UI Dialog時,必須將頁面上的值傳送到隱藏的Dialog表單,通常使用時都是在這裡出錯,例如取不到列表上的值,或是取值方法不對,或是取到值卻放不進隱藏表單的input欄位,這樣就無法執行寫入或更新了。

參考資料:

http://www.oncoding.cn/2009/jquery-input-value/

Categories: Javascript, jQuery, jQuery UI Tags: ,

解決圖層被Flash擋住的終極方法

2010年11月10日 尚無評論

如果網頁上有 Flash 的話,往往 Flash 會把彈出的圖層或是使用jQuery dialog彈出的視窗給擋住,(FF除外,IE6,7,8均出現被擋情況)

解決辦法就是給Flash設置透明的參數:wmode="transparent"。

並在 embed 標籤中設置 wmode="transparent"

如果使用 AC_FL_RunContent,可以加多一對參數 'wmode','transparent' 即可。

如:

<script type="text/javascript">
AC_FL_RunContent( 'codebase',
'http://download.macromedia.com/pub/shockwave/cabs/flash/swflash.cab#version=7,0,19,0',
'width','741','height','230','src','../swf/s_banner','quality','high','pluginspage',
'http://www.macromedia.com/go/getflashplayer','movie','../swf/s_banner',
'wmode','transparent'); //end AC code
</script>

如果還是有問題,可以嘗試給 Flash 外面增加一個 DIV 標籤,並給他設置 z-index:0; 的樣式即可。